Why can’t populations indefinitely continue to grow exponentially?
Populations cannot grow exponentially indefinitely. Exploding populations always reach a size limit imposed by the shortage of one or more factors such as water, space, and nutrients or by adverse conditions such as disease, drought and temperature extremes.
What prevents a population from growing forever?
Limiting factors include a low food supply and lack of space. Limiting factors can lower birth rates, increase death rates, or lead to emigration. … Competition for resources like food and space cause the growth rate to stop increasing, so the population levels off.
Why do populations tend to grow?
Initially, growth is exponential because there are few individuals and ample resources available. Then, as resources begin to become limited, the growth rate decreases. Finally, the growth rate levels off at the carrying capacity of the environment, with little change in population number over time.

Why is exponential growth rarely observed in nature?
Few populations in nature grow exponentially. No population can continue such growth indefinitely. … At higher densities, limited resources cause growth rate to decline, and populations stabilize at carrying capacity. A limiting factor is a property of a population’s environment which restricts population growth.
Which type of growth occurs when population growth slows or stops?
Logistic growth
Logistic growth occurs when a population’s growth slows or stops following a period of exponential growth.What type of growth can occur only when a population has unlimited resources?
45.2A: Exponential Population Growth. When resources are unlimited, a population can experience exponential growth, where its size increases at a greater and greater rate.

Is the human population increasing or decreasing?
Global human population growth amounts to around 83 million annually, or 1.1% per year. The global population has grown from 1 billion in 1800 to 7.9 billion in 2020. … However, the global human population is projected to peak during the mid-21st century and decline by 2100.How do limited resources affect a population?
